What no contact with an affair partner means?

In the ‘no contact’ policy parties outside the affair relationship are directing the conclusion of the relationship and not the two people within it. These parties are the spouse or partner who did not have the affair and the therapist.

What is affair fog?

Experts say it’s a phenomenon called « affair fog, » which occurs when the person engaging in an affair is hyperfocused on the excitement of a new relationship and cannot properly understand the mistake they are making.

Where do most affairs happen?

The workplace. The workplace is where most affairs begin. It doesn’t hurt that we usually dress nicely and are on “good behavior” at work. Plus, having shared passions about projects (or mutual annoyance at a boss or co-worker) provides the perfect breeding ground for an affair.

Can affairs lead to true love?

Because the odds are against you. You should know that the odds are heavily against going from an affair to a long-term, lasting relationship. Some research suggests that about only one in 10 affairs lead to a long-term relationship. Of these, only about 10% are permanent.

Should I tell my husband details of my affair?

In my own survey of 475 therapists, 38 percent agreed that « a spouse’s desire to know details of the partner’s extramarital involvement should be discouraged by the therapist. » In general, I support sharing the specific information that the betrayed partner needs to know.

What happens when an affair ends abruptly?

An affair that is suddenly exposed or ends poses a particular risk situation for a vulnerable marriage with an unfaithful spouse. Feelings of loss, conflict and pressure can make it difficult to let go of the illicit relationship, compounding the lure that led to the affair in the first place.

How affairs affect the brain?

The Neurochemicals of Love and Lust

They are part of the brain’s reward system. These feelings intensify to compel lovers to seek mating partners. The chemicals that stimulate the motivation and drive system in the brain are the neurotransmitters epinephrine, dopamine, serotonin, and phenylethylamine (PEA).

How long does affair fog infatuation last?

With time, typically 6 months to 4 years, the body acclimatises to these chemicals and our feelings subside. The so called honeymoon period of new relationships which eventually wanes allowing the feelings of romantic love to mature into a more companionate type love.

How long does Limerence last in an affair?

The reality is limerence never lasts – typically it spans from 6-36 months. Just long enough for us to pair-bond and continue the survival of the species.
